Skywalking版本选择时如何考虑安全性?

在当今数字化时代,应用程序的复杂性和规模都在不断增长,因此,对于系统性能的监控和问题追踪变得尤为重要。Skywalking 是一款开源的APM(Application Performance Management)工具,能够帮助开发者实时监控和追踪应用程序的性能。然而,在众多Skywalking版本中,如何选择一个既满足监控需求又保障安全性的版本,成为了许多开发者关注的焦点。本文将深入探讨Skywalking版本选择时如何考虑安全性。

安全性是选择Skywalking版本的首要考虑因素

Skywalking是一款开源项目,虽然其功能强大,但在使用过程中,安全性问题不容忽视。以下是选择Skywalking版本时,如何考虑安全性的几个关键点:

1. 优先选择官方推荐的版本

官方推荐的版本通常经过了严格的测试和验证,安全性相对较高。在选择Skywalking版本时,应优先考虑官方推荐的版本,以确保系统的安全性。

2. 关注版本的安全更新

随着技术的发展,新版本可能会修复一些已知的安全漏洞。因此,在选择Skywalking版本时,要关注版本的安全更新情况,及时升级到最新版本,以避免潜在的安全风险。

3. 评估社区活跃度

社区活跃度是衡量一个开源项目安全性的重要指标。一个活跃的社区能够及时发现并修复安全漏洞,提高项目的安全性。在选择Skywalking版本时,可以参考GitHub、Stack Overflow等平台上的社区活跃度。

4. 考虑版本的功能与安全性平衡

Skywalking提供了丰富的功能,但在使用过程中,过多的功能可能会导致系统安全风险。在选择版本时,要根据自己的实际需求,权衡功能与安全性的关系,避免因功能过多而带来的安全风险。

案例分析:某企业选择Skywalking版本的经历

某企业是一家大型互联网公司,为了实时监控和追踪应用程序的性能,选择了Skywalking作为APM工具。在版本选择过程中,该公司充分考虑了以下因素:

  1. 优先选择官方推荐的版本:该公司选择了官方推荐的最新版本,以确保系统的安全性。

  2. 关注版本的安全更新:该公司定期关注Skywalking版本的安全更新,并及时升级到最新版本。

  3. 评估社区活跃度:该公司参考了GitHub、Stack Overflow等平台上的社区活跃度,选择了社区活跃度较高的版本。

  4. 考虑版本的功能与安全性平衡:该公司根据实际需求,选择了功能与安全性平衡较好的版本。

通过以上措施,该公司成功地将Skywalking应用于生产环境,有效提升了系统的性能和稳定性。

总结

在Skywalking版本选择时,安全性是首要考虑因素。通过优先选择官方推荐的版本、关注版本的安全更新、评估社区活跃度以及考虑版本的功能与安全性平衡,可以有效保障系统的安全性。希望本文能为您提供有益的参考。

猜你喜欢:网络性能监控